Use Your PVCs to Vote in Good Governance, PDP Tells Kwara Residents

Date: 2023-01-03

Ahead of the general elections, the Kwara Peoples Democratic Party(PDP) Governorship Campaign Council has urged the people of the state to get their permanent voter's cards (PVCs) from the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) in order to enable them vote for good governance.

A statement issued in Ilorin yesterday, by state PDP Campaign Council Director of Media and Publicity, Mr. Kayode Ogunlowo and made available to journalists to mark the 2023 new year, noted that getting of the PVCs remained a way to end the alleged misrule of the APC led administration in the state.

The statement stated that, “the abysmal maladministration of the ruling APC in the state can only be rescued, restored, and reformed by the PDP when voted back to power through the PVCs.”

Ogunlowo affirmed that, “the goodies enjoyed by the good people of Kwara during the PDP days have been lost under the AbdulRazaq-led APC government in the state.”

He further said Kwara could only be put back on the right track by the #KwaraRescueMissionTeam of the PDP in the state.
